(function () {
const hs = [“yimenapp.com”, “yimenapp.net”, “yimeapp购物网页制作napp.cn”];
for (var i = 0, len = hs.length; i < len; i++) {
if (location.host.endsWith(hs[i])) {
document.write(”);
break;
}
}
})();
随着智能手机和移动互联网的普及,移动应用程序(App)已经成为人们生活和工作中必不可少的一部分。但是,为了让更多人能够访问应用程序,将应用程序转换为网页的需求越来越大。这篇文章将介绍如何将App转换为网页,并解释这背后的原理。
一、为什么需要将App转换为网页?
在许多情况下,将App转换为网页是很有必要的。这里列举一些原因:
1. 针对没有安装App的用户。有时候,用户可能不想安装App,或者他们的设备不支持App。这时,将App转换为网页就可以为这些用户提供服务。
2. 提高用户体验。有时候,用户可能需要在一个更大的屏幕上使用App,这可以提高用户体验。
3. 可以更好的管理和维护。将应用程序转换为网页后,可以更方便地管理和维护。
二、如何将App转换为网页?
将App转换为网页的方法有很多种,这里介绍两种主要的方法:移动网页和混合应用程序。
1. 移动网页
移动网页是一种基于Web的解决方案,可以使应用程序在移动设备上运行。移动网页通常使用HTML5、CSS和JavaScript等Web技术。其优点是可以跨平台运行,并且不需要安装任何应用程序。但是,移动网页也有一些缺点,例如性能可能不如原生应用程序,并且某些高级功能可能无法实现。
2. 混合应用程序
混合应用程序结合了Web和原生应用程序的优点,因此也被称为“原生Web应用程序”。混合应用程序可以使用Web技术来开发用户界面,同时也可以使用原生应用程序的功能,例如访问设备硬件和其他API。混合应用程序通常使用框架来实现,例如Apache Cordova和Ionic等。混合应用程序的优点是可以提供更好的用户体验,并且可以使用设备的硬件和其他API。但是,混合应用程序也有一些缺点,例如开发成本可能会比较高,并且可能需要专门的开发技能。
三、将App转换为网页的原理
无论是移动网页还是混合应用程序,将App转换为网页的原理都是使用Web技术来实现应用程序的用户界面。HTML、CSS和JavaScript等Web技术可以用于创建网页,包括应用程序的用户界面网页版app开发教程。此外,Web技术还可以用于创建动画、转场和其他视觉效果,使网页看起来更像一个应用程序。
移动网页和混合应用程序的主要区别在于它们如何处理应用程序的功能。移动网页通常使用JavaScript来实现应用程序的功能,例如数据存储、网络连接和其他API。另一方面,混合应用程序可以使用原生应用程序的功能,例如访问设备硬件和其他API。
总之,将App转换为网页可以提高用户体验,并为那些没有安装App的用户提供服务。移动网页和混合应用程序是将App转换为网页的两种主要方法,它们都使用Web技术来实现应用程序的用户界面。